#43041c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#43041c is composed of 26.3% red, 1.6%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94% magenta, 58.2%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 337.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 13.9%. #43041c color hex could be obtained by blending #860838 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#43041c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0105 is the darkest color, while #fff8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#43041c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#252223 is the less saturated color, while #46011b is the most saturated one.
